AIBB Guide – Vendor Finance and Business Sales
The popularity of vendor finance is often cyclical. In tougher economic times, like the current state of the economy, when banks are limiting lending to business buyers, vendor financing becomes a viable if not a key selling point for a business sale. This Guide by Kafrouni Lawyers and the Australian Institute of Business Brokers (AIBB) answers many of the important questions faced by a seller and buyer of a business in coming to terms on vendor finance.
